Singapore legislation

Clause 85

of Online Safety (Relief and Accountability) Bill

Clause 85

Tort of online impersonation

(1)

A person (X) must not conduct any online activity that constitutes online impersonation if the online activity is likely to cause a victim harassment, alarm, distress or humiliation.

(2)

If X contravenes subsection (1), the victim of the online impersonation may bring civil proceedings in a court against X.

(3)

In any proceedings mentioned in subsection (2), it is a defence for X to prove —

(a)

that X’s conduct was reasonable; or

(b)

that X had reasonable grounds to believe that the victim consented to the online impersonation.

(4)

In this section, “victim”, in relation to online impersonation, means the victim mentioned in section 15.
